Reverend Dr. Patrick Perryman

Senior Pastor

Patrick is a gifted preacher, accomplished theologian, inspired teacher and fully present in the lives of our members and community – since 2010. He leads the staff, guides the congregation and moderates the church Session. Patrick has been in ordained ministry since 1998, with a Master of Divinity from Columbia Theological Seminary and a Doctor of Ministry from Fuller Theological Seminary. Patrick is approachable, warm and has a unique ability to bring both an intellectual and fresh approach to scripture in his teaching and preaching. He is an avid reader, enjoys spending time with family and friends, and loves the beauty of the Lowcountry. Patrick is a devoted husband to his wife Sissy, and is an engaged father with their college-aged children Walker and Holland.

Geneva Baxley

Associate for Ministry: Children, Families and Membership

Geneva is an incredible blessing to our church family bringing creativity and spiritual depth to our vibrant family ministries. As a lifelong Presbyterian, she leads our youngest disciples, preschoolers and elementary-aged children, along with their families in spiritual formation, fellowship, and fun! Geneva has a passion for children, infusing in them lifelong memories of fellowship, music, service and exploration of the Christian faith. Geneva also welcomes and helps make connections with those wanting to learn more about membership at First Pres through our New Member classes. Geneva has a rich background in both performing arts and the medical field receiving two degrees – one from Otterbein University (Bachelor of Fine Arts) and one from Duke University (Accelerated Bachelor of Science in Nursing). She enjoys being outside and playing on the water with her husband, Luke, and two young children Kate and Davis.

Ellie Laita

Director of Youth Ministries

Ellie joins us after being in youth ministry for more than 25 years in Los Angeles. She brings energy and spiritual depth to a vibrant, welcoming and mission-based youth program open to both members of our congregation and friends in the community. Ellie received a degree from Loyola University (Bachelor in Fine Arts) and has enjoyed a career in performing arts. In addition to her position at First Pres, Ellie continues as an accomplished working actress, enjoys surfing and beach volleyball, and spending time with her two college-aged daughters, Alex and Olivia. 

Jordan Plair

Director of Music

Jordan leads and directs the adult choir and oversees the music ministry at First Pres. She has more than 11 years of experience as a church musician and music educator leading choirs, ensembles and students. She graduated from Presbyterian College in 2009 with a degree in Music Education. Jordan brings a great deal of enthusiasm for choral singing and church music to the many talented vocalists at First Pres. At home, Jordan loves reading and baking and of course her two beautiful children.

Lily Cooper

Organist

Lily is an accomplished musician who studied piano throughout her childhood and mastered the organ at Erskine College. She has a Masters in Library and Information Science from the University of South Carolina and retired in 2018 from a career as a school media specialist in SC Title 1 public schools. Lily is a lifelong Presbyterian. Her father was a Presbyterian minister, her husband Sam is a retired Presbyterian minister, and one of her three sons is preparing for ordination in the Presbyterian Church (USA).
